The choice between a direct flight and a flight with a transfer depends on your priorities. Direct flights are usually faster and more convenient, but they are more expensive. Flights with transfers can be cheaper, but they take more time and may be less comfortable. If you value time and comfort, choose a direct flight. If you want to save money, choose a flight with a transfer.
Before your flight, be sure to familiarize yourself with the airline’s baggage allowance rules to avoid unpleasant surprises at the airport. Usually, airlines allow you to carry one piece of hand luggage and one piece of checked baggage free of charge. If you are traveling with a transfer, make sure you have enough time for the transfer and that your baggage will be automatically transferred to your final destination. Most flights involve one transfer, but direct flights are also available. The choice depends on your priorities regarding time and cost.
A direct flight is suitable if time and comfort are important. A flight with a transfer may be cheaper but will take more time.
A direct flight takes about 14-15 hours. Flights with transfers can take from 16 to 24 hours or more, depending on the transfer duration.
Baggage restrictions depend on the airline and class of service. Usually, one piece of hand luggage and one piece of checked baggage are allowed.
Make sure you have enough time for the transfer. Find your terminal and gate, and take advantage of the airport’s amenities, such as shops and cafes.
Most flights arrive at John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K). Sometimes flights may arrive at other New York airports.
You can get to the center of New York by taxi, bus, AirTrain train, or subway.
